This village is classified entirely rural at the 2011 Census, so urban population share does not apply. Density, land area and decadal growth are not published in the Primary Census Abstract. See Methodology.

Bathne in context

With 4,543 people at the 2011 Census, Bathne was the 315th most populous of its district's 1110 villages, above the district average of 3,897.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 974, 51 above the rural national 923.
